FAA remarks for KIFP

  • ESTABD PRIOR TO 1959.
  • MTNS NW, NE, E AND SE. RISING TRRN N & S OF RWY ENDS.
  • ACTVT REIL RWY 16 & 34; PAPI RWY 16 & 34; MIRL RWY 16/34 - CTAF.
  • SVCS & FUEL 0600-2200 - 122.85; AFT HR NA.
  • 941-323-2178.
  • PCR VALUE: 480/F/A/X/T
  • 66 FT PLINE PARL TO RWY 625 FT L 1300 FT FM RWY END.
  • PAPI UNUSBL BYD 7 DEGS RIGHT OF CNTRLN.
  • TPA FOR LIGHT ACFT 999 FT AGL, TPA FOR HIGH PERFORMANCE ACFT 1499 FT AGL.
  • TWY ALPHA 4 LTD TO WINGSPANS LESS THAN 79 FT.
  • CTN: LRG COML OPS AFT ATCT HRS; BIRDS ON & INVOF ARPT SEP-DEC.
  • NOISE SENSITIVE AREAS NE & SE.
  • SFC COND UNMNT 0600Z-1200Z.
  • TWY A5 BTN TWY A & GEN AVN APRON LTD TO WINGSPAN LESS THAN 79 FT.
  • RADAR SVC BLW 6000 FT NA.
  • GA LNDG FEE - 928-754-2134.

Published verbatim from the FAA NASR subscription. Abbreviations are the FAA's own.

Approach coverage

Both ends of Laughlin/Bullhead Intl’s sole runway have published instrument approaches, so procedure coverage is not confined to one alignment. Two RNAV (GPS) procedures provide satellite-based options, while the VOR procedure adds a ground-based alternative. The 8,501 ft runway offers substantial length, although 16/34 remains the field’s only alignment.
